Billy,

The RA Territorials OSD cap badge is in my opinion a poor fake.

The badge is from a very worn die, the laurel spray almost disappearing its that worn.

Bearing in mind all these TF badges were made over a hundred years ago they were of very good quality and as you suspect 99% solid backed.

The rear of the other looks chemically aged also.
